Just out of curiosity, do you have filtering bridge enabled? -----Original Message----- From: Michael Mee [mailto:mm2001 at pobox dot com] Sent: Sunday, November 30, 2003 6:43 PM To: m0n0wall at lists dot m0n0 dot ch Subject: [m0n0wall] upgrade failed on pb20 w/ bridge -> new rule needed Short version: I upgraded from pb18 to pb20 and the wireless interface which is bridged to my ethernet stopped passing traffic, sort of. The fix: 1) under Firewall->Rules. click '+' for a new rule 2) change Interface to "WLAN" (or whatever you called your wireless lan) 3) change Source to Type "LAN subnet" 4) enter a description, e.g. WLAN -> any 5) click "Save" 6) click "Apply Changes" on the following rule summary page Somehow this relates to the DNS and other firewall entries I was seeing in the log (see earlier message). Somehow, though, some wireless users continued to surf ok. Probably until their local DNS cache failed. Apologies if I missed this problem/solution in earlier email.
